Personally, I think an admirable quality of some games is to really stay games, without making use of excessive cutscenes, written back stories, totally scripted and linear dialogue and explicit milestones, which are all things that more often than not detract from the immersion. If you can make the plot develop through gameplay itself rather than sifting through pages of back story or hours of cutscenes, you are doing a Good Thing.
On the other hand, I enjoy some games that have movie-like qualities, but they mostly get away with it because of some brilliant gameplay element.
